EDITORS COMMENTS
This chromolitho print captures a poignant moment in history as it portrays the abandoned child, Joseph Wilmot, entering a Dr Barnardo's children's home. The image, created by an English School artist in the 19th century, showcases the charitable work of Dr Barnardo and his organization. In this illustration from Bubbles, edited by Dr Barnardo and published in London around 1895, we witness the compassionate act of saving a young boy from poverty and homelessness. Joseph stands at the doorstep of hope with uncertainty etched on his face while wearing tattered clothes that reflect his difficult circumstances. The lithograph beautifully depicts the contrast between darkness and light as Joseph steps into a brighter future through the open door. This powerful visual symbolizes not only his physical rescue but also represents countless other children who found solace within these homes. The image serves as a reminder of both the challenges faced by disadvantaged children during this era and the philanthropic efforts dedicated to their well-being. It highlights how organizations like Dr Barnardo's played a vital role in providing shelter, support, and opportunities for those who had been abandoned or left vulnerable due to economic hardships.
